I don't buy Wal-Mart anymore because they have almost no seeds in their packets. I do go to lowes from time to time and the selection is very nice. I also do cheap seeds. I also do thomas and morgan when they have a sale. I am addicted to Brecks for bulbs when they have the 25.00 dollar coupon available. On E-Bay the place to buy from are seeds for thee. Talk about a great deal you get masses of seeds for a very low price. But the best deals are in the seed exchange right here at a gardener's forum. The price can't be beat and I've collected almost 300 different types of seeds just by trading with others.

Pinetree seeds are very inexpensive and have never let me down. I also get their glad bulbs and potatoes and other things. The seed packet prices are always around $1 whereas other companies are $3. I believe their website is www.superseeds.com
